Counsel for defendant having moved for permission to proceed as a poor person and assignment of counsel on the appeal taken from an order of the Cayuga County Court, entered October 15, 2008,

Now, upon reading and filing the affidavit of Philip Seaton, sworn to August 26, 2008, the notice of motion with proof of due service thereof, and due deliberation having been had thereon,

It is hereby ORDERED that the motion be, and the same hereby is, denied.

Memorandum: The order denying a modification petition pursuant to Correction Law 168-o is not appealable. To the extent that People v Higgins (55 AD3d 1303 [2008]) may be read to hold otherwise, the parties never raised, and this Court did not consider, the issue of appealability.
